Mel Gibson Salutes Trump During Weekend UFC Match And Social Media Is Triggered 

Award-winning actor and filmmaker Mel Gibson recently drew ire on social media after he was seen saluting former President Donald Trump at a UFC match they both attended near Las Vegas over the weekend.

Gibson was caught on camera making a “military-style” salute to Trump as the former Republican chief executive walked and waved through a crowd where the actor was.

Gibson and Trump attended the UFC 264 match between Conor McGregor and Dustin Poirier on Saturday — where Trump was met with  cheers and applause as he entered the venue. 

The video  attracted widespread social media attention as it circulated online. Gibson, known for his starring roles in “The Patriot” and “Braveheart,” was seen standing near former President Trump’s way as he walked through the crowd and was there seen saluting Trump.

Gibson has not explained what his salute to Trump meant — or if he really did so, although some accounts posted about him being at the UFC match with his sons.

While it is unknown whether Gibson, 65, is backing President Trump — he is certainly not among the vocal celebrity supporters of the former president like Jon Voight, Kirstie Alley, Dean Cain or Roseanne Barr among others.

In 2016, he even dissed Trump’s plan to build a wall along the US-Mexico border. He was also silent during the 2020 election when Trump ran for reelection against now-President Joe Biden.

Former President Trump publicly said that he is considering a rematch against Biden in 2024, although no formal announcement has been made yet on his final decision to run again.

Last year, the award-winning actor told Fox News that he is simply not qualified to make political statements.

“Who the hell cares what I think?” he said that time. “I’m not an expert — what am I qualified to talk about?”
